        Extract article or news by url or html, parse the title and content, output in markdown format.
        
        
        ## How to install
        
        `article-parser` is available on pypi
        https://pypi.org/project/article-parser/
        
        ```
        $ pip install article-parser
        ```
        
        ## Basic Usage
        
        ```python
        >>> import article_parser
        
        article_parser.parse(
          url='',               # The URL of the article. optional
          html='',              # The HTML of the article. optional
          proxies={},           # The Proxies to bypass anonymity, security and prevent IP blocking.
          options={
            'markdown': True,   # Output in markdown format. defult True. optional
            'threshold': 0.9,   # Content ratio threshold. defult 0.9. optional
            'timeout': 5        # Request webpage timeout time, in seconds, default 5. optional
          })
        
        ## ouput markdown
        >>> title, content = article_parser.parse(url="http://www.chinadaily.com.cn/a/202009/22/WS5f6962b2a31024ad0ba7afcb.html")
        
        ## output html
        >>> title, content = article_parser.parse(url="http://www.chinadaily.com.cn/a/202009/22/WS5f6962b2a31024ad0ba7afcb.html", options={'markdown': False})
        ```
